Mercurial > hg > orthanc
comparison OrthancServer/FromDcmtkBridge.h @ 1695:18c02c6987d5
fix for encodings
author | Sebastien Jodogne <s.jodogne@gmail.com> |
---|---|
date | Thu, 08 Oct 2015 14:34:19 +0200 |
parents | 06d579e82bb8 |
children | a001f6226c7c |
comparison
equal
deleted
inserted
replaced
1694:06d579e82bb8 | 1695:18c02c6987d5 |
---|---|
122 | 122 |
123 static DcmElement* CreateElementForTag(const DicomTag& tag); | 123 static DcmElement* CreateElementForTag(const DicomTag& tag); |
124 | 124 |
125 static void FillElementWithString(DcmElement& element, | 125 static void FillElementWithString(DcmElement& element, |
126 const DicomTag& tag, | 126 const DicomTag& tag, |
127 const std::string& value, | 127 const std::string& utf8alue, // Encoded using UTF-8 |
128 bool interpretBinaryTags); | 128 bool interpretBinaryTags, |
129 Encoding dicomEncoding); | |
129 | 130 |
130 static DcmElement* FromJson(const DicomTag& tag, | 131 static DcmElement* FromJson(const DicomTag& tag, |
131 const Json::Value& element, | 132 const Json::Value& element, // Encoding using UTF-8 |
132 bool interpretBinaryTags); | 133 bool interpretBinaryTags, |
134 Encoding dicomEncoding); | |
133 }; | 135 }; |
134 } | 136 } |